JLPT N3 Japanese self-study · ~15 min · Heard / looks like / seems: らしい・ようだ・そうだ
'I heard Tanaka quit.' 'The sky is dark, it looks like it's about to rain.' These three all mean 'seems like' but are used differently.
What you'll learn
- Understand らしい (hearsay/rumor)
- Understand ようだ (based on observation)
- Understand そうだ appearance (looks like it's about to...)
